Can you also explain how the E30 is better than the K5 even though they have the same chip

So imo it’s not really about the chip itself, it’s about the implementation about that chip, and the other components surrounding it that make the difference imo. The k5 pro dac implementation is more leaning on the brighter neutral side, and also somewhat lean. The e30 is a bit more w shaped sounding (but still relatively neutral), and a bit more natural sounding with a bit better detail and technicalities. Also a more powerful sound. This is because imo topping knows how to better implement this chip, and also put more care into the output stage of this chip giving it the superior sonic qualities

Eventually I want to get the LCD-2C or the LCD-GX but I didn’t know if they had the sound signature I would prefer. But now you just told me it’s warmer and bassier. What does “darker” mean?

Edit: Found this Dark refers to a prominent bass with recessed treble.

Warm refers to a prominent bass with usually neutral treble.

Not necessarily prefer over the xx, just saying something you would like as well (but who knows). Dark means reduced treble, so some find that they lack treble energy for them. I also personally don’t think the gx would be up your alley, you prefer the lcd 2 classic.
